DC Entertainment will begin releasing Direct Market repackages of the material originally released in the 100-Page Giants placed in Walmart in July, the company announced today. The stories will be packaged in six-issue monthly miniseries, with two chapters per issue.
Superman: Up in the Sky #1, written by Tom King with art by Andy Kubert and Sandra Hope and new cover art by Andy Kubert, will street July 3.
Batman Universe #1, by Brian Michael Bendis and Nick Derington, with new cover art by Derington, will street July 10.
Wonder Woman: Come Back to Me #1, by Amanda Conner, Jimmy Palmiotti, and Chad Hardin, with new cover art by Conner, will street July 17.
The Walmart program began last summer with three 100-Page Giants, Superman Giant, Justice League of America Giant, Batman Giant, and Teen Titans Giant (see "Walmart to Carry Exclusive DC Comics in 3,000 Stores").
